Eve, or rather the top half of her, is shown standing naked under the tree of the knowledge of good and evil in the garden of eden, where the grey coiling snake placed above to the right symbolizes satan the seducer. Object Type: painting. Genre: religious art. Date: circa 1531. Dimensions: height: 52 cm (20.4 in); width: 44.4 cm (17.4 in). Medium: oil on panel. Collection: National Museum in Wrocław. Cranach Eve
